The Central Bank of Russia has put into circulation a commemorative coin to celebrate the four-hundredth anniversary of Naberezhnye Chelny, featuring a KAMAZ truck and the city’s coat of arms.
The Bank of Russia has issued a commemorative silver coin dedicated to the significant date – the four-hundredth anniversary of the founding of the city of Naberezhnye Chelny. As reported by the regulator's press service, the coin with a denomination of three rubles is part of the "Cities" series, and its mintage will be limited to a total of three thousand copies. The reverse side of the coin features relief images of the official coat of arms of the city, the city hall building, and a modern business center, as well as a KAMAZ truck against the backdrop of a panoramic cityscape, created using laser matting technique. The image is complemented by the inscriptions "Naberezhnye Chelny" and the anniversary date "400 years." The Central Bank particularly emphasized that Naberezhnye Chelny is rightly considered the heart of Tatarstan's industry, and the history of the automotive giant KAMAZ is inextricably linked to this city, from which the first truck rolled off the assembly line exactly fifty years ago. The obverse side traditionally features the state emblem of Russia and standard designations. It is worth noting that earlier, coins related to Tatarstan were issued by the Central Bank in 2022. The steel 10-ruble coin "Kazan" was issued as part of the "Cities of Labor Valor" series, and in 2020, the Bank of Russia issued commemorative coins for the 100th anniversary of the TASSR with a denomination of 3 rubles.
